Sanak Retreat Bali
4.7/547 Reviews
Munduk
One of our two favorite hotels on our Indonesia Trip. Its a boutique nature retreat with cozy and tastefully decorated bungalows midst the rice paddies with amazing mountain views from all sides. The area is very rural dont expect any restaurants nearby but the food here is tasty, fresh and creative, you dont feel you are missing anything. We had a private picnic by a nearby waterfall and a Water Blessing at a nearby natural spring by a real Balinese priest, both experienes we will never forget The spa is another highlight but need to bookef early for the same day We both had four hands massage, just pure bliss. The staff is so natural friendly and helpful all from the villages around. Since the hotel only has 11 bungalows they are quickly full.but we booked early .Highly recommended for someone who wants to stay away from crowded areas like the south or Ubud and loves nature.

Villa Sande
4.2/52 Reviews
Munduk
I rarely write a review for an accomodation although i have stayed at lots hotel from resort type to small motel. However this Villa Sande have made me keep complementing them. It is a boutique nice villa complex in a quiet area surrounding with a really amazing nature view, there are paddies and mountain in front. Can also do a tracking down to a small river and jungle, just nearby walking from the villa. Despite of the lovely villa, what make me surprised and grateful is their manager, Ibu Putu and the staffs (Pak Yudi, Mbok Kadek, bu Iluh n another Yudi). All are very accomodating, helpful and friendly. I came with a group of 8 persons which need some extra special care, especially for the food and eating time. And they sincerely help me to provide it everyday during our five days staying there. It is even not a five star resort but what they did made me give them 7 star. Thank you and great job for the team! I highly recommend Villa Sande to the people who are not only looking for a nice and quite stay in this area, but also the best hospitality!
